What’s Involved in Water Softener Installation
• We test your water hardness and size the right system for your household.
• We recommend the system type that fits your home, water, and budget.
• Our licensed plumbers install and plumb the unit to code.
• We program the regeneration cycle for your water and usage.
• We verify soft water at the tap and walk you through the system before we leave.
What Does Water Softener Installation Cost in Des Moines?
Water softener installation in Des Moines typically runs $1,200 to $3,800 installed, with most systems landing in that range depending on capacity, according to Angi.
